Giant-Man [Henry Pym]; Wasp [Janet Van Dyne]; Human Top [Dave Cannon]
This is it, Jan!
Human Top steals civil defense plans and wants to sell them to the Communists. Giant-Man lures him into a trap and captures him.

Tom Morton; Jack Morton; Ellen Morton; Johnny Morton
From the time he was a little boy, Tom Morton had the "wanderer's itch."
A man who has travelled the world and seen wonders performed by hermits in India returns home to find that his young nephew creates magic with only belief.

Centaurians; Mongoids
Behold the awesome Mongoids, intergalactic warriors, as they plan their next conquest...
Aliens transform a spy into a human, but because they can only receive black-and-white images from Earth they leave him green and he is discovered.

The Wasp [Janet Van Dyne] (narrator); Rack Morgan; Sam
When she's not on a case with Giant-Man, Janet Van Dyne devotes a great deal of time visiting...
The Wasp tells the tale of future mercenary pilot Rack Morgan who disobeys the rules once too many.
